miércoles, enero 19, 2005

Monitorizacion de procesos



Posiblemente con este curro con FDS (Fast Data Search) me tocará monitorizar los procesos para poder encontrar cuellos de botellas.
Para ello tendré que usar herramientas tanto en Unix como en Windows.
En este post me voy a centrar en Windows. La idea es ver que herramientas tengo disponibles y sobre todo ver cuales tengo disponibles con el SO.

La mas conocida es taskmgr (Task Manager). Otra no tan conocida es el msinfo32 (Información del Sistema).

Pero con esas no nos basta, necesitamos algo mas para poder ver por ejemplo fallos de pagina a nivel de proceso.

Solucion: googlear un poco.

El primer sitio encontrado de interés fue Windows Server troubleshooting. Tiene muy buena pinta, pero como mi interés se centraba en descubrir herramientas, tampoco lo he mirado mucho.
Eso si, me sirvió para intuir que Microsoft tiene algo y un sitio muy bueno [sysinternals.com]. Tiene bastantes utilidades con muy buena pinta. De ellas he probado el 'Process Explorer'.

De microsort se pueden realicen la siguiente busqueda, que saca resultados interesantes.
Bueno al grano, no se como llegue a ella, pero la siguiente pagina es la buena, va sobre Performance Monitoring en Windows 2000 (que era lo que me interesaba). Esta dentro de los Resource Kits.

Y ya acabando, la herramienta clave es perfmon.exe (Performance Monitor). Se puede acceder a ella desde el panel de control -> herramientas administrativas.

Con ella ya podemos mirar diversos contadores a nivel de proceso, que es lo que nos interesaría.









No hay comentarios: